HC Deb 22 February 2000 vol 344 c974W
Mr. Swayne

To ask the Minister of Agriculture, Fisheries and Food (1) what representations he has received from airlines regarding the pet travel scheme; [109362]

(2) when he plans to include airlines in the arrangements available under the pet travel scheme. [109360]

Ms Quin

All airlines flying into the UK were invited to express interest in taking part in the Pet Travel Scheme. Eight have done so. Discussions are still underway with the following airlines with a view to agreeing their "Required Methods of Operation":

  • British Airways,
  • British Midland,
  • Finnair, Iberia Airlines,
  • Lufthansa,
  • Qantas.

Once these have been agreed the airlines concerned will be able to enter the scheme.
